svnversion is the right tool.
But it does not really help, as we have a classical "hen and egg" problem:
You need to commit your changes and you need to update to get correct
svnversion output. Now you need to start make again to generate the
source which results in a modified source which need to be commited,...
> Furtheron this modified piece of source would be a steady source of
> merge errors.
>
Why would you want to commit the file containing the version number
anyway? That is clearly the wrong approach, for all the reasons you
list. I would simply run svnversion every single time make is invoked
and link the resulting version string into the program.
